f9e89e5532
This enables get command to operate on a handle range so multiple attributes values can be printed out: uart:~$ gatt get 0x0001 0xffff attr 0x00506600 uuid 2800 perm 0x01 00000000: 01 18 attr 0x00506600 uuid 2803 perm 0x01 00000000: 20 03 00 05 2A attr 0x00506600 uuid 2a05 perm 0x00 attr 0x00506600 uuid 2902 perm 0x03 00000000: 00 00 attr 0x00506600 uuid 2803 perm 0x01 00000000: 0A 06 00 29 2B attr 0x00506600 uuid 2b29 perm 0x03 00000000: 00 attr 0x00506600 uuid 2803 perm 0x01 00000000: 02 08 00 2A 2B attr 0x00506600 uuid 2b2a perm 0x01 00000000: AA 2D 05 EB E8 1D D0 E5 F7 B9 C1 B6 3F 66 93 15 attr 0x00506600 uuid 2800 perm 0x01 00000000: 00 18 attr 0x00506600 uuid 2803 perm 0x01 00000000: 0A 0B 00 00 2A attr 0x00506600 uuid 2a00 perm 0x09 00000000: 74 65 73 74 20 73 68 65 6C 6C attr 0x00506600 uuid 2803 perm 0x01 00000000: 02 0D 00 01 2A attr 0x00506600 uuid 2a01 perm 0x01 00000000: 00 00 attr 0x00506600 uuid 2803 perm 0x01 00000000: 02 0F 00 A6 2A attr 0x00506600 uuid 2aa6 perm 0x01 00000000: 01 attr 0x00506600 uuid 2803 perm 0x01 00000000: 02 11 00 04 2A attr 0x00506600 uuid 2a04 perm 0x01 00000000: 18 00 28 00 00 00 2A 00 attr 0x00506600 uuid 2800 perm 0x01 00000000: 0D 18 attr 0x00506600 uuid 2803 perm 0x01 00000000: 10 14 00 37 2A attr 0x00506600 uuid 2a37 perm 0x00 attr 0x00506600 uuid 2902 perm 0x03 00000000: 00 00 attr 0x00506600 uuid 2803 perm 0x01 00000000: 02 17 00 38 2A attr 0x00506600 uuid 2a38 perm 0x01 00000000: 00 attr 0x00506600 uuid 2803 perm 0x01 00000000: 08 19 00 39 2A attr 0x00506600 uuid 2a39 perm 0x00 Signed-off-by: Luiz Augusto von Dentz <luiz.von.dentz@intel.com> |
||
---|---|---|
.. | ||
CMakeLists.txt | ||
Kconfig | ||
bredr.c | ||
bt.c | ||
bt.h | ||
gatt.c | ||
hci.c | ||
hci.h | ||
l2cap.c | ||
ll.c | ||
ll.h | ||
rfcomm.c | ||
ticker.c |